What Is the Cost of Living Near Virginia Beach?

Understanding the cost of living near Virginia Beach is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Ascis.
Virginia Beach's Cost of Living Index is approximately 101.8 (1.8% more expensive than US average; 2.2% less than VA average). Large coastal city, tourism, military, housing near US avg. HRT bus/light rail. When planning your budget based on a salary from Ascis,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$1,300 - $1,900+ A significant portion of Ascis sal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$140 - $230 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$70 (HRT monthly pass)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$410 - $600 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$400 - $730+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$380 - $700+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$2,600 - $4,160+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
